Daily Programs

Daily activities include swimming, canoes, horseback riding, crafts, recreation, nature study, outdoors, and low ropes course. Fishing and hiking, cookouts, playing in Kelly's Creek, sports and games, riflery and archery all add to the fun. The older campers of 2009 will be the first campers to experience the thrill of our new high ropes course.

The pool staff are certified lifeguards who give swim tests at the beginning of the session, teach short daily skilled swimming lessons on campers' levels, and observe their free swims. All campers are under the buddy system while at the pool.
All campers have an opportunity to ride horses several times during the week. All our horses are gentle enough for non-riders. Horse activities are under close supervision.
This schedule varies somewhat, but a typical day's schedule would be
7:00 - Rise and shine!
7:45 - Breakfast
8:30 - Clean up and morning devotion
9:00 - First program
10:00 - Second program
11:00 - Third program
12:00 - Back to huts to freshen up
12:30 - Lunch
1:00 - Break and rest period
2:00 - Fourth program
3:00 - Fifth program
4:00 - Sixth program
5:00 - Free swim (thirty minutes)
6:15 - Dinner
6:45 - Hillside
7:00 - Prepare for night activity
8:00 - Night activity
